【flink连接hive flink连接redis】导读:
Flink是一个分布式流处理框架,可以与多种数据源进行连接 。其中,Redis是一种高性能的NoSQL数据库,常用于缓存和实时数据处理 。本文将介绍如何使用Flink连接Redis,实现实时数据处理 。
1. 添加依赖
首先,在Flink项目中添加redis客户端依赖:
在Flink程序中,需要创建Redis连接 。可以使用RedissonClient来创建连接:
Config config = new Config();
config.useSingleServer().setAddress("redis://127.0.0.1:6379");
RedissonClient redissonClient = Redisson.create(config);
其中,127.0.0.1:6379为Redis服务器的地址和端口号 。
3. 使用Redis
连接成功后,就可以使用Redis了 。例如,可以使用RedissonClient获取Redis的RMap对象,并对其进行操作:
RMap map = redissonClient.getMap("myMap");
map.put("key", "value");
String value = http://data.evianbaike.com/Redis/map.get("key");
4. 关闭连接
最后,记得关闭Redis连接:
redissonClient.shutdown();
总结:
本文介绍了如何使用Flink连接Redis 。通过添加依赖、创建Redis连接、使用Redis和关闭连接等步骤 , 可以实现Flink与Redis的连接 。这样就可以在Flink程序中使用Redis进行实时数据处理,提高程序的性能和效率 。
推荐阅读
- redis实现抢红包 redis抢单java
- Redis缓存失效通知
- redis查看操作日志 redis任务记录
- redis需要几台服务器 一个项目用几台redis
- rediserror晋江 REDIS_ERR
- 用redis打造实时排行榜 redis海量用户排行榜
- redis部署架构 redis部署灾难
- 如何更改服务器以适应战火与秩序? 战火与秩序怎么改服务器